Patent number: 9636742Abstract: A binder composition for making foundry molds, comprising an acid-hardening resin, one or more 5-position-substituted-furfural compounds selected from the group consisting of 5-hydroxymethylfurfural and 5-acetoxymethylfurfural, and one or more compounds selected from the group consisting of urea and derivatives of urea, wherein the content of the 5-position-substituted-furfural compound(s) by percentage is from 1 to 60% by weight of the binder composition. The content of the compound(s) by percentage selected from the group consisting of urea and derivatives of urea is preferably from 0.3 to 10% by weight of the binder composition.Type: GrantFiled: March 12, 2013Date of Patent: May 2, 2017Assignee: KAO CORPORATIONInventors: Takashi Joke, Toshiki Matsuo

Patent number: 9463504Abstract: A curing agent composition for making foundry molds, comprising 2,6-dihydroxybenzoic acid. In a sand composition for making foundry molds, it is preferable to use simultaneously: an acid-hardening resin which contains both a binder composition for making foundry molds which comprises one or more 5-position-substituted furfural compounds selected from the group consisting of 5-hydroxymethylfurfural and 5-acetoxymethylfurfural, and the curing agent composition for making foundry molds which comprises 2,6-dihydroxybenzoic acid. It is preferable that the content of 2,6-dihydroxybenzoic acid in the curing agent composition is 10 to 80 wt %.Type: GrantFiled: March 14, 2013Date of Patent: October 11, 2016Assignee: KAO CORPORATIONInventors: Takashi Joke, Toshiki Matsuo

Patent number: 9200140Abstract: Disclosed is a binder composition for mold formation including: one or more 5-position substituted furfural compounds selected from the group consisting of 5-hydroxymethylfurfural and 5-acetoxymethylfurfural; and a furfurylated urea resin. The content of the 5-position substituted furfural compound(s) in the binder composition for mold formation is preferably from 1 to 30% by weight, and the content of the furfurylated urea resin is preferably from 1 to 20% by weight.Type: GrantFiled: October 30, 2012Date of Patent: December 1, 2015Assignee: KAO CORPORATIONInventors: Toshiki Matsuo, Takashi Joke, Masayuki Kato

Patent number: 8822568Abstract: A binder composition for self-curing mold formation, comprising at least one condensate (A) selected from furfuryl alcohol condensate and furfuryl alcohol/formaldehyde condensate, and an acid-curable resin (B), wherein about the condensate(s) (A), the presence ratio by mole of its/their furan rings (a) to the total of its/their methylol groups (b), methylene groups (c) and oxymethylene groups (d), a:(b+c+d), is from 1:1.00 to 1:1.08, and the content by percentage of the at least one condensate (A) is from 0.3 to 8.0% by weight.Type: GrantFiled: December 17, 2010Date of Patent: September 2, 2014Assignee: Kao CorporationInventors: Masayuki Kato, Toshiki Matsuo, Tomofumi Kanzawa, Takashi Joke

Patent number: 8813829Abstract: In production of a mold with the reclaimed spherical molding sand having a sphericity of 0.95 or more and mainly composed of Al2O3 together with the binder containing the acid-hardening resin and the hardening agent (I), at least one of the hardening agents (I) and (II) that is used in production of a mold from which the reclaimed molding sand is obtained contains the organic sulfonic acid, and in the hardening agent, a content of sulfuric acid is not more than 5% by weight and a content of phosphoric acid is not more than 5% by weight.Type: GrantFiled: April 27, 2009Date of Patent: August 26, 2014Assignee: Kao CorporationInventors: Yoshimitsu Ina, Shigeo Nakai, Toshiki Matsuo

Publication number: 20130008625Abstract: The present invention provides a binder composition for use in mold manufacturing that is capable of preventing a deterioration in the mold strength in a high-humidity environment, and further restraining the generation of an irritant gas at the time of casting; and a mold manufacturing composition wherein this binder composition is used. In order to provide such the binder composition, the binder composition for use in mold manufacturing, comprises a furan resin, and a metal compound containing one or more metal elements selected from the group consisting of elements in the Groups 2, 4, 7, 10, 11 and 13 of the periodic table, wherein the content by percentage of the metal element(s) in the binder composition is from 0.01 to 0.70% by weight, and the metal compound is one or more metal compounds selected from hydroxides, nitrates, oxides, organic acid salts, alkoxides, and ketone complexes.Type: ApplicationFiled: March 18, 2011Publication date: January 10, 2013Applicant: KAO CORPORATIONInventors: Akira Yoshida, Toshiki Matsuo
